fundie baby voice

A very effeminate, breathy, high-pitched and childlike vocal style adopted by grown women prominently from an extreme evangelical Christian background.

Not to be confused with a natural accent as it's a technique learned by adult women to express a very submissive tone, mainly towards their male companion. It's a signal towards men around them that they know, like their children, they aren't at all equal in the family dynamic. So she relinquishes away most of the responsibilities and decision-making to their other half of the married relationship. Leaving cooking, cleaning, and child-rearing traditionally being the only duties to ever focus on.

Famously heard in evangelical Christian circles, as well as the tradwife fad.

Fundie Baby Voice

A type of speech pattern learned and adopted by grown women of extreme (typically evangelical ) Christian belief.

It's characterized as an overtly effeminate, high-pitched but breathy tone popular among fundamentalist circles and the online tradwife fad. Not to be construed as a natural accent, Fundie Baby Voice is less of a dialect and more of a signal. As this isn't how most adult women naturally speak. It's a signal the woman shows off among her male partner/husband with fellow practitioners of that faith of exactly where she knows she lands on the family dynamic.

Simply put, the woman talks literally in the pitch of a child because that's what's expected a wife to be like among her peers.

It's an adopted throwback from a time behind the 1950s and the "traditional" family unit. No sense of equal partnership there, just pure submission.
